  • 7.13 Remodeling. In addition to Franchisee's obligations to comply with all System Standards in effect from time to time, CB Franchising may require Franchisee to undertake and complete a Remodel of the Location to CB Franchising's satisfaction. Franchisee must complete the Remodel in the time frame specified by CB Franchising. CB Franchising may require the Franchisee to submit plans for CB Franchising's reasonable approval prior to commencing a required Remodel. CB Franchising's right to require a Remodel is limited as follows: (i) the Remodel will not be required in the first two or last two years of the term (except that a Remodel may be required as a condition to renewal of the term or a Transfer), and (ii) a Remodel will not be required more than once every five years from the date on which Franchisee was required to complete the prior Remodel.

What This Means (2024 FDD)

According to Chocolate Bash's 2024 Franchise Disclosure Document, CB Franchising has the right to require franchisees to remodel their locations to meet current brand standards. The FDD specifies that Chocolate Bash may require a franchisee to undertake and complete a remodel of their location to CB Franchising's satisfaction, and within a timeframe specified by them. Franchisees may also be required to submit remodel plans for approval before starting the work. The document defines "Remodel" as a refurbishment, renovation, and remodeling of the Location to conform to current standards for building design, exterior facade, trade dress, signage, fixtures, furnishings, equipment, decor, color schemes, presentation of the Marks, and other System Standards.

However, there are some limitations to this requirement. Chocolate Bash cannot require a remodel during the first two or last two years of the franchise term, with the exception of a remodel required as a condition for renewal or transfer of the franchise. Additionally, remodels cannot be required more than once every five years, calculated from the completion date of the previous remodel.

This means that as a Chocolate Bash franchisee, you need to be prepared for the possibility of undertaking a significant remodel of your location every few years to keep it aligned with the brand's current image. This can involve substantial costs, so it's important to factor these potential expenses into your financial planning. Understanding the timing and frequency of required remodels, as well as the potential costs, is crucial for assessing the long-term financial viability of the franchise.
